Hello, I have an existing ZFS pool as below and when I start the storage in the GUI it successfully imports and mounts the pool (as confirmed via the SSH console) however the GUI is constantly in the "mount disks" state and as such some GUI features like shares don't show properly. My pool does have a SLOG and Read Cache on the ZFS pool, and although I don't expect Unraid to understand them I would assume it will just ignore them and just continue in the GUI. Is there a way to tell the GUI that it should just accept that it is mounted? pool: tank state: ONLINE config: NAME STATE READ WRITE CKSUM tank ONLINE 0 0 0 raidz2-0 ONLINE 0 0 0 sdf1 ONLINE 0 0 0 sdg1 ONLINE 0 0 0 sdh1 ONLINE 0 0 0 sdj1 ONLINE 0 0 0 sdi1 ONLINE 0 0 0 logs mirror-1 ONLINE 0 0 0 sdd1 ONLINE 0 0 0 sde1 ONLINE 0 0 0 cache sdd2 ONLINE 0 0 0 sde2 ONLINE 0 0 0 errors: No known data errors It is mounted and open. :~# mount | grep zfs tank on /mnt/tank type zfs (rw,noatime,xattr,posixacl)
